Jumbos Sit in Fourth After Strong First Day at Duke Nelson Invitational

MIDDLEBURY, VT (September 14, 2024) - The Tufts University men's golf team opened up their season with a strong showing at the Duke Nelson Invitational, as they sit in 4th place of 22 teams in the tournament hosted by Middlebury College.

The four best scores for the Jumbos on the par 71 course total up to 302 strokes, just one stroke back of Middlebury and Hamilton, who are tied for second. They trail the tournament leaders Hartford by three strokes.

Leading the charge for the Jumbos was sophomore Nick McCabe, who hit for an eighth best three over par (74). Just a stroke back was senior Eric Lancellotti, who sits tied for 15th with a 75.

Rounding out the top four scorers for Tufts was junior Holden Kittelberger and sophomore JP Noone, who each hit for a 76 on day 1.

Hamilton's Ramon Aroca Gonzalez leads the individual scores with a stellar 70 in round 1.

The Jumbos will tee off for day 2 at 11:00 AM, Sunday, September 15.
